Pony.ai and BAIC BJEV: A Strategic Move Towards Autonomous Mobility



On January 10, 2026, Pony.ai, a renowned name in the realm of autonomous driving, teamed up with BAIC BJEV, the manufacturing wing of BAIC Group, to bolster their existing partnership. This collaboration is strategic in nature, focusing on the development and deployment of robotaxi services in a more structured manner.

Expanding the Partnership


The updated partnership signifies a commitment to addressing significant challenges pertaining to the scaling of Level 4 (L4) autonomous driving. Both companies are investing efforts to transition from smaller pilot programs to large-scale sustainable commercial operations. With a comprehensive approach, they plan to refine the design and production of robotaxi models that are optimally tailored for autonomous functions while enhancing the user experience inside the vehicles.

This collaboration emphasizes establishing a solid framework conducive to large-scale robotaxi deployment. In addition to designing vehicles, Pony.ai and BAIC BJEV will deepen their cooperation in various segments of the autonomous mobility lifecycle, such as user acquisition, fleet management, and ongoing vehicle maintenance. By capitalizing on BAIC BJEV's robust manufacturing capabilities, the partnership aims to minimize the overall costs associated with producing autonomous vehicles.

Past Achievements and Future Prospects


Together since 2024, Pony.ai and BAIC BJEV have successfully introduced the Arcfox Alpha T5 Robotaxi at the Shanghai Auto Show. With upwards of 600 units produced, these vehicles are now in active service in Beijing and Shenzhen, showcasing the swift advancement in autonomous vehicle technology. The Alpha T5 model is particularly noteworthy for its improved user experience, thanks to Pony.ai’s advanced technologies in virtual driving and world modeling.

Covering operations in various countries, including Luxembourg and Singapore, Pony.ai looks to broaden its reach by entering strategic markets like Europe and the Middle East with the Alpha T5 model. The inherent advancements in comfort and convenience embedded in this robotaxi not only aim to enhance ride quality but also foster greater acceptance of autonomous transport among the general public.

Since their partnership inception, they have jointly allocated nearly RMB 1 billion towards the research and commercialization of autonomous driving technologies. As this partnership matures, further investments are anticipated, aligning with their shared goals of technology advancement and global market expansion.
